The newly released PCI-1670 from ProMicro is a high performance PCI-bus card with a GPIB interface. The card is fully compatible with IEEE 488.1 and 488.2 standards with its PCI 2.1 bus specification. With two driver control modes, controller mode and slave mode, the PCI-1670 can perform basic IEEE 488 talker, listener and controller functions required by IEEE 488.2. The user can also connect up to 15 GPIB instruments making the card especially suitable for instrument measurement and control.
The PCI-1670 is available for Windows 95/98/NT/ME/2000/XP and DOS and it supports complete drivers and libraries. To make driver development easier, the PCI-1670 comes with example drivers programmed in Visual C++, Borland C++ Builder, Labwindows/CVI, Visual Basic, Delphi and LabVIEW.
Powerful testing features and a configuration utility allows users to easily access and control instruments. The PCI-1670 offers a comprehensive supplementary controller driver database and provides NI-like commands to help users develop applications. Users can use an interactive GPIB window interface to control devices directly without any need of programming.
